Describe the existing conditions on the site and general land use in the vicinity of the project at the time of this application: The site is an electrical Substation. Continuing stream channel erosion has eroded 45' of Substation fence causing serious safetX conscerns and potential severe environmental damage. Page 6 of 14 9. Describe the overall project in detail, including the type of equipment to be used: A large track hoe will be used to clear an access point to the stream for repair. A coffer dam will be placed upstream of the work area and the existing stream flow will be pumped around the work area. The foundation will be excavated and cleaned out and a washed stone base will be constructed for the wall to start. The stream channel will be shaped with the track hoe and stabilized with riparian vegetation. The base of the Gabion wall will be constructed and wired together. Then the second layer of baskets will be installed and wired together. At this point the stream impact will be complete and the pump around process will cease. The Gabion wall will continue up with backfilling and stone placement being done from the top of the stream bank from the first row of baskets up. Once complete the area will be seeded or stabilized with stone if inside the substation. 10. Explain the purpose of the proposed work: Stabilize an eroding stream bank to protect an existing substation . IV. Installation of the Gabions Baskets to stabilize the eroded stream bank will be done using a trackhoe and other support eduipment to yet the job done as quickly as passible and limit the amount of time that the stream is impacted during construction. The existing stream will be pumped around the work area to avoid any un-necessary stream siltation. The foundation of the Gabion wall will be excavated below the existing stream bed to provide stability. The stream channel will be slightly modified in shape to prevent stream channel erosion in other areas. The current channel erosion is severe and the stream will onlybenefit from. the proposed work. This work is basical~ Emergancy Stabilization for Sub-Station security. VIII.
